Based on the Solunar Theory (John Alden Knight): fish and wildlife tend to feed more during the periods when the moon is overhead or underfoot (major) and at moonrise/moonset (minor). The score considers the lunar phase and the crossing of major periods with the local high tide.

📘 About Port Macquarie Tide Forecast

Found at -31.43° S latitude and 152.91° E longitude, Port Macquarie serves as a prominent coastal location in Australia. Its tidal pattern is mixed semi-diurnal (unequal tidal heights across the day), with a mean tidal range of 1m and spring tides reaching up to 1.2m. The small tidal range makes anchoring small fishing boats straightforward, as the same spot remains accessible throughout the day. Sport fishers in mixed tide regions target the day's higher high tide when chasing predatory coastal fish. The continental shelf morphology in this area amplifies or attenuates tidal waves arriving from the open ocean.
